MARCELLA BAHL, 16, KILLED IN ACCIDENT NEAR STE. MARIE ~ A one-car accident early Sunday morning September 5, 1965, took the life of sixteen-year-old Marcella Louise Bahl, the da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Ralph Bahl of Rt. 1, Dundas.  It is believed she was killed instantly.

The accident occurred at about 12:10 a.m. Sunday, approximately four miles south of Ste. Marie on the blacktop.  Miss Bahl was a passenger in the car driven by Gregory Phillips, 18, of Noble.

According to investigating Illinois State Police, the car was proceeding south on the blacktop when it ran off the west edge of the road into a bridge railing. The railing passed through the entire right side of the vihicle. It was raining at the time of the accident.

Phillips was admitted to Richland Memorial Hospital and is listed in "fair" condition this morning.

Marcella Bahl was born on September 4, 1949. She was a junior student at East Richland High School.

Besides her parents she is survived by seven brothers and sisters, Norma, Jerome, Joyce, Donna, Fred, Annette and Richard, all at home.

Also surviving are grandparents, Mrs. Veronica rennier of Oblong and Mr. and Mrs. Noah Bahl of West Liberty.

The Funeral Mass held at St. Joseph's Catholic Church, Stringtown with Rev. Fr. Stephen Roedder officiating. Interment in the church cemetery.

Published in Olney Daily Mail (IL) ~ September 7, 1965
